FIFA 21 FUT Birthday Team 2 start time On April 2, EA SPORTS rolls out the carpet for FIFA 21 FUT Birthday Team 2. This will include another selection of high-rated FUT cards, and there will be 11 in total. Team 2 is set to release at 6pm (GMT). That means 10am (PT), 12pm (CT), 1pm (EST), and 3am (AES). FIFA 21 FUT Birthday Team 2 card design This year they feature a pink and purple theme \u2013 perfect colors to celebrate the game mode\u2019s birthday. Lightning rounds Lightning rounds are big discounts on the biggest packs in Ultimate Team. While it\u2019s unclear as to whether or not FUT Birthday will include this offer, it\u2019s certainly not out of the question. Special packs At the time of writing, there has been no indication that EA SPORTS will be adding special FUT Birthday packs to the store. However, that doesn\u2019t mean you won\u2019t be able to pack the players included in the promo through other means.
